Question

calcium carbonate contains 40% calcium, 12rbon and 48% oxygen by mass. knowing that law of constant composition holds good, calculate the mass of the constituent elements present in 2g of calcium carbonate.

Solution

The formula for calcium carbonate is CaCO3
The relative atomic mass of calcium = 40
The relative atomic mass of carbon = 12
The relative atomic mass of oxygen = 16.

Calcium carbonate contain one atom of calcium, one of carbon and three of oxygen.
Thus the formula weight of CaCO3 = 40+12+48=100.

So, calcium carbonate contains 40% calcium, 12% carbon and 48% oxygen by mass.
